For Children

 

The Elgin Library is a very kid-friendly place! We have a variety of programs aimed at young readers to enhance their love of reading and learning, creating and making, and interacting and playing. 

Preschool Story Hour: every Wednesday from September through May from 10:30 a.m. to 11:00 a.m.

  • Bring your 3-5 year-olds for a half hour packed with stories, games, music, and activities. 
     
  • Parents can drop their young ones off, or they may stay to help or to enjoy the quiet, homey atmosphere of our library and check out materials for themselves!
     
  • Registration is required, so give Lisa a call or email to say you'd like to attend or use the online form: https://www.elgin.lib.ia.us/services/children/preschool-story-time
  • We will begin when have a group registered and parents will be notified.

Check It Out! After School Clubs at the library

To attend, kids and parents can register at the library and choose which clubs are of interest. Then a calendar of club meetings will be available online and reminders will be on Facebook. Kids can ride The NFV Valley site's buses to the library or come on their own or with a parent from 2:30 to 4:00 p.m. to have some fun and learn a lot! Parents are welcome to stay to help, browse books, or can simply pick up when the program is done, or at closing time at 5:00. Snacks are always provided by the Friends of the Library. Those with food allergies are encouraged to bring their own snack. Check the calendar on the HOME page to see which clubs meet! Or check out the page here.

Outreach to Schools

Library Lisa visits the preschool through 4th grade classrooms on a regular basis throughout the school year. She reads lots of stories, does book talks, and makes it easy for all students to check out books from the Elgin Public Library! Ask Lisa or call 426-5313 for more information!
